Prep Time: 20 mins
Cook Time: 40 mins
Total Time: 1 hrs
Cuisine: Italian
Serves: 8 servings

Ingredients

  1. Gluten-free lasagna noodles
  2. Cooked chicken
  3. Ricotta cheese
  4. Mozzarella cheese
  5. Parmesan cheese
  6. Spinach
  7. Alfredo sauce
  8. Garlic

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Ensure the oven rack is positioned in the middle for even cooking.
  2. Prepare the gluten-free lasagna noodles according to package instructions. Drain and rinse with cold water to prevent sticking. Set aside.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, combine ricotta cheese, minced garlic, and chopped spinach. Mix thoroughly until well incorporated.
  4. Shred or dice the cooked chicken into bite-sized pieces, ensuring even distribution for layering.
  5. Grease a 9x13 inch baking dish with olive oil or cooking spray to prevent sticking.
  6. Begin layering the lasagna: Start with a thin layer of Alfredo sauce on the bottom of the dish.
  7. Place a layer of gluten-free lasagna noodles over the sauce, slightly overlapping to cover the entire surface.
  8. Spread a portion of the ricotta and spinach mixture evenly over the noodles.
  9. Add a layer of shredded chicken on top of the ricotta mixture.
  10. Sprinkle mozzarella and Parmesan cheese over the chicken layer.
  11. Pour additional Alfredo sauce to cover the layer, ensuring moisture throughout the dish.
  12. Repeat the layering process: noodles, ricotta mixture, chicken, cheeses, and sauce until all ingredients are used.
  13. For the final layer, top with remaining mozzarella and Parmesan cheese.
  14.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il, ensuring it doesn't touch the cheese.
  15. B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es covered.
  16.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es until the cheese is golden and bubbly.
  17. Remove from oven and let rest for 10-15 minutes before serving to allow the lasagna to set.
  18. Slice into 8 equal portions and serve hot. Garnish with fresh parsley or basil if desired.

Tips

  1. Choose High-Quality Gluten-Free Noodles: Not all gluten-free pasta is created equal. Look for brands that hold their shape well during cooking to prevent a mushy texture.
  2. Prevent Dryness: The key to a great gluten-free lasagna is moisture. Don't be shy with the Alfredo sauce, and cover the dish while baking to keep it from drying out.
  3. Room Temperature Ingredients: Allow your cheeses and cooked chicken to s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es before assembling. This helps create more even layering and consistent cooking.
  4. Make Ahead Friendly: This lasagna can be prepared in advance and refrigerated. Just add 10-15 minutes to the baking time if cooking directly from the refrigerator.
  5. Customize Your Protein: While the recipe calls for chicken, you can easily substitute with turkey or even use a vegetarian protein alternative.
  6. Cheese Tip: For extra richness, mix a little cream cheese into the ricotta mixture for a more luxurious texture.
  7. Garnish Matters: Fresh herbs like basil or parsley not only add a pop of color but also bring a fresh flavor that cuts through the richness of the dish.
